    Boetsma's Joe H. & Thelma (Harris) Boetsma   1959/1960-1979
      They were originally at 115 W. Mill Street behind the EUB church.

      He retired in 1979, but retained ownership of the building until 1993.

    Boetsma Receives Award

    BOETSMA HOME FURNISHINGS RECEIVES MARKETING A WARD

    Boc tsma Home Furnishing of Culver was awarded a 'Best Service Dealer" citation last Friday for it's creative marketing program.

    The "Best Service Dealer Award" is a national recognition by General Electric Credit Corporation of retailer's who use innovative method's of direct mail marketing to their customersin connection with advertising promotion efforts using other media. Joe Boersma, president of the store, received the plaque from James Richey Branch Manager for GE Credit in the Culver area. "We are proud that we have been able tn participate in helping make the direct mail sector of your total advertising program such an outstanding success." Mr. Ritchey said. He added that G E Credit has put it's compuuterized credit promontioon severives at the disposal of retailers throughout the country on a planned monthly basis and that Boetsma Home Fzurnishings has made outstanding use of these sevices in it total promotion efforts to its customers.

    New Manager At Boetsma’s
      Culver - Larry Boetsma is now in his third week as the new manager of Boetsma Home Furnishings, Culver.

      His dad, Joe, formerly operated the business, which has been in the same location on West Jefferson since 1961.

      Larry said that he wished his dad well in his retirement. He also stated that various changes in the operation are being made and he hopes the old and new customers will drop by for coffee and a chat or just to browse.

      One important change will be in the new expanded price range. Larry said, “In addition to current styles and price ranges, we are adding more affordable quality furniture.”

    Since from about 2008 this property has been up for tax sale several times and been redeemed. It on tax sale as such on 21 Oct 2013, 20 Apr 2014 and the a certificate sale on 23 Apr. 2015 no offical owner has been named.
